Millie David Shines in First Match for England’s Women

In a stunning debut for England, 20-year-old winger Millie David made her mark by scoring a try against Wales. This exciting moment took place during the 2026 Women’s Six Nations tournament at Ashton Gate, where England secured a strong 12-0 lead.

David’s first appearance was a significant highlight for the England team, known as the Red Roses. Her impressive performance not only thrilled the fans but also showcased her potential as a rising star in women’s rugby.
